JFW Industries, a long-established manufacturer of radio-frequency (RF) components, is providing the CATV and Satellite Models portfolio with a range of precision-engineered attenuators, loads, splitters, taps and termination products designed to support satellite communications and cable television infrastructure. These products are already widely deployed across commercial and institutional networks, where predictable RF performance, signal integrity and long-term reliability are critical.

JFW’s CATV and satellite models are built to manage signal levels, impedance matching and power dissipation within satellite communication chains and broadband distribution systems. The product line includes fixed and variable attenuators, coaxial terminations, directional couplers, power dividers and loads, all designed to operate across commonly used satellite and CATV frequency bands. These components play a fundamental role in conditioning RF signals, protecting sensitive equipment and enabling accurate signal measurement and calibration within ground-based satellite systems. They are commonly used in teleport facilities, gateway stations, earth stations, network operations centers and satellite integration and test laboratories. These models are designed with tight electrical tolerances to ensure repeatable attenuation values, low voltage standing wave ratio (VSWR) and stable performance across temperature variations typical of indoor and outdoor ground installations. Mechanical designs emphasize robust connectors, durable housings and consistent impedance control, supporting long service life in fixed infrastructure as well as mobile or transportable satellite terminals.


The USB-controlled model 50P-2154 is a solid-state programmable attenuator designed for fast and precise attenuation control. It offers attenuation steps of 1, 2, 4, 8, 16, and two 32 dB steps, with a switching speed of just 4 microseconds. The insertion loss is performance-optimized with 4.9 dB typical at 2000 MHz, 5.1 dB at 4000 MHz, and 6.7 dB at 8400 MHz, not exceeding 7.5 dB across the full frequency band. The unit features SMA female connectors and delivers a typical VSWR of <1.6:1.


The Ethernet-controlled model 50PA-1300 is a rack-mountable programmable attenuator assembly that supports up to 8 independently controlled attenuators. It combines solid-state step attenuators with both Ethernet and RS-232 remote control interfaces, as well as manual control via a front-panel display and keypad. Designed with lab and rack integration in mind, it is enclosed in a 19-inch rack-mount chassis. The typical insertion loss values are 5.2 dB at 2000 MHz, 5.8 dB at 4000 MHz, and 7.5 dB at 8400 MHz, with a maximum of 8.5 dB across the operating band. It operates within a temperature range of 0ºC to +50ºC, and its VSWR performance is typically <1.7:1.


The TTL-controlled model 50P-2152 also features solid-state attenuation with ultra-fast 1-microsecond switching speed. Like the USB model, it supports up to +24 dBm input power and uses SMA female connectors. It shares the same insertion loss profile as the USB variant, with a maximum of 7.5 dB over the full 400–8400 MHz range and a typical VSWR of <1.6:1. JFW’s CATV and satellite models are used across broadcast distribution networks, broadband satellite gateways, government and defense communication facilities and enterprise satellite links. In broadcast and CATV systems, the products help manage signal distribution across complex networks with multiple branches and loads. In satellite systems, they support uplink and downlink chains by enabling precise signal conditioning, protecting high-value equipment and maintaining measurement accuracy during commissioning and maintenance.
